    They can easily make it fit with the lore. In FFXI there was only one shiva/ifrit/garuda etc, and they got around it by giving out their power in the form of 'avatars', the same could be done here.
    In addition to that, even if summoner doesnt fit perfectly how does that affect the other jobs? mammets are already in the game which would be awesome PUP pets (or engineer or whatever), and we have plenty of different beast species with more to come hopefully.

    Also, necromancers have been in final fantasies (V and XI at least, Lamia were often necromancers and there were a few NPCs you could interact with who were too. I believe those Aqueducts in CoP supposedly had a necromancer in them) before, that said I'd much prefer to see some more interesting and uniquely-final fantasy pet jobs first.
